Hi Guys,

This has happened to me now twice and not sure what the heck is going on, or what I have to do to fix it. I own a 2013 Jetta. I have went to start it with my main key/remote (used daily), and it starts and shuts right off. A code comes up that reads "Key Error". The vehicle will start with my spare key (full key with remote), as normal. What in the world could be causing this? Affraid that I am going to get stuck somewhere? Is it possible to get just a regular key made with out the remote unit on it? Will that even help. I am worried that I won't have both keys with me and I will be stuck!!!!!
